Follow the steps in your handbook to access the key fob's battery compartment and then remove it. You can replace the battery yourself by following these simple steps: Place your key fob's button down on a smooth surface and gently lift the cover away from the retaining clips. Avoid touching the battery's flat surfaces as fingerprints can eat away the life of the battery. Major auto parts shops and retailers offer replacement batteries for CR2016 coin cells.
